06-05-2020 09:20 AM
Hi:
In order for the sim card to work, your notebook has to have the optional WWAN card as set forth in the note in the screen shot you posted.
Your notebook would need to have one of these model WWAN cards, which would appear under the Network Adapters device manager category.
HP lt4120 Qualcomm® Snapdragon X5 LTE Mobile Broadband Module
HP hs3110 HSPA+ Intel® Mobile Broadband Module
If you don't see either of those devices listed, than you cannot connect to the internet using a SIM card.

06-12-2020 03:55 PM
Well, the good news is you have the antenna cables to install the card.
So, what you do is to buy one of the supported WWAN cards listed in the service manual.
You must buy one with the HP part number on it.
You can probably find the one you want pretty cheaply on eBay.
Search by the HP part number, not the model of the WWAN card.
HP lt4120 LTE/EVDO/HSPA+ SnapdragonT X5 LTE Mobile Broadband Module HP part # 800870-001
HP hs3110 HSPA + Intel Mobile Broadband Module HP part # 822828-001
I don't know which one is better.
